Located in the middle of the Judean desert, near the northwestern shore of the Dead Sea, lies the ancient settlement of Qumran. This barren landscape, surrounded by rugged hills and cliffs, is an unlikely place for habitation. Yet, for nearly a century, this area was home to a mysterious and secretive community whose impact on history cannot easily be overstated.

In this episode of Holy Land Revealed, we explore the history and significance of the sectarian settlement at Qumran. Our guide on this journey is Dr. Jodi Magness, a renowned archaeologist who has spent over two decades studying the site. With her expertise, we dive into the mysteries of this fascinating and complex community.

We begin our tour at the edge of the settlement, where the first discoveries were made in the mid-20th century. Dr. Magness explains how the initial findings revealed a complex system of buildings, including ritual baths, living quarters, and a dining hall. We explore these areas, getting a glimpse into the day-to-day life of the community. We also examine the intricate water collection system, which allowed the inhabitants to thrive in this otherwise inhospitable desert.

As we move deeper into the settlement, Dr. Magness unveils the secrets of the community's religious beliefs. She explains how the community was likely composed of members of a Jewish sect known as the Essenes, who held strict beliefs regarding Jewish law and ritual purity. The Essenes were known for their eschatological beliefs, which focused on the end of the world and the coming of a messiah. Dr. Magness helps us understand how these beliefs influenced every aspect of life at Qumran.

Perhaps the most famous discovery at Qumran was the large collection of ancient manuscripts found in the surrounding caves. Dubbed the Dead Sea Scrolls, these texts date back to the Second Temple period and include important biblical and non-biblical texts. Dr. Magness takes us on a tour of the cave where the first scrolls were found and explains how these texts have illuminated our understanding of Judaism and Christianity in the ancient world.

Of particular interest is the relationship between the community at Qumran and the early Christian movement. Some scholars argue that there was a direct connection between the two, while others suggest more indirect influence. Dr. Magness lays out both sides of this debate, helping us understand the complexity of this topic.

As we wrap up our exploration of Qumran, Dr. Magness reflects on the significance of this settlement. She explains how the community's beliefs and practices were at odds with the dominant Jewish hierarchy of the time, and how their insistence on purity and eschatological beliefs may have helped shape the future of Judaism and Christianity. With a deep understanding of this unique community, we walk away with a new appreciation for the enduring legacy of Qumran.
